On July 19, 2021, the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) released a (PIN 20210719-001), to warn entities associated with the Tokyo Summer Olympics about cyber actors looking to negatively impact the event via malicious activities including dist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ks, ransomware, social engineering, phishing campaigns, or insider threats to interfere with live broadcasts of the event, compromise sensitive data, or impact public or private digital infrastructure supporting the Olympics.
The FBI to date is not aware of any specific cyber threats against these Olympics, but encourages associated entities to remain vigilant and maintain best practices in their network and digital environments.
